With the World Cup quarterfinal match between Argentina and Germany less than an hour away, things are heating up at the FIFA Fan Fest™ in Port Elizabeth.
The relatively small crowd that arrived early at St George's Park soon started growing as a steady stream of supporters arrived at the gates.
Those already inside are being entertained by the soulful sounds of DJ Martyr, which will be followed by the kick-off at 4pm.
Port Elizabeth has been blessed with glorious winter weather and the FIFA Fan Fest is the perfect venue from which to enjoy the live broadcast on the massive screen.
A feast of local entertainment will keep the crowd occupied until 8.30pm when Spain and Paraguay are due to take the field for the last match of the day.
Entrance to St George's Park is free.
